A porte-cochere (something not often seen on the North Shore and defined as a doorway to a building or courtyard, “often very grand” through which vehicles can enter from the street)  and columned portico are clues to what lies ahead in this one-of-a-kind brick residence built in 1926.

The yard is fully fenced and boasts a heated pool, landscaped gardens, and specimen plantings. A screened porch overlooks the yard. The house offers five bedrooms, three full baths, and two half baths. The updates have all been tastefully done without spoiling any of the specialness that makes this home unique.
The details are swoon-worthy – fine millwork, paneled doors and hardware, crown molding, wainscoting, hardwood floors, radiators (which are so often removed in favor of baseboard heating) a stunning curved staircase leading to the second level, French doors, and two wood-burning fireplaces.
The layout is very livable. The kitchen has a center island, breakfast nook, and butler’s pantry. The baths have been updated, but not too updated. The mudroom and laundry room add functionality. There are suites on both floors that can be used as a master.
Walker Street is about a mile from the town center and close to Route 128.
